Question: 1. If I were the Shepard in the story and found a golden ring that made me invisible I think that I would get into a lot of mischief. I say that because there are a few things that I can think of that I would want to do and I would only do these things I if possessed these powers. One of the first things I would do is go to a luxury car lot and grab one of the keys out of the office and joy ride in the nicest luxury car I could. I think the reason I would do this is because I have had some serious bad luck with cars in the past so it has caused me to not exactly have the car of my dreams. I think my use of the ring would definitely be considered unethical by most people. I think that we value ethics more than we realize because even with the ring on I could consciously make the decision to not do anything wrong but because I know that I wouldn't get caught I lose all values and ethics. I think most people in society would consider me to be ethical because I try to live a just life. I am often putting others needs before mine this has always been a value that I grew up. My parents always taught us to live by the golden rule and to show honor and integrity no matter where we go in life. I think if I had the ring and use it as tool to do what I wanted and get what I wanted then my response does agree with Glaukon's claim. When wearing the ring I would justify was I was doing would be okay because it would be considered a harmless pleasure.
